Question Amavis RelayedOpenRelay


Hello,

I have a mail server running Amavis and Postfix, which were configured from a web-based tutorial.

I really have no idea about the inner workings of these email protection solutions, and I really hope I've configured them correctly.

However, in my Logwatch, I see lines like this:

Code:
1   (702006-13) Passed UNCHECKED-ENCRYPTED {RelayedOpenRelay}, [127.0.0.1] [xx.xx.xx.xx]
What does "RelayedOpenRelay" mean ?
It means that my Postfix is open ? I really hope not!

I've done some testing at mxtoolbox.com and it doesn't seem to be open.
However, I think mxtoolbox.com tests on Port 25.
What about other open ports used by Amavis ?

I really don't know the flow of events of how these solutions work.

I googled for a few hours before I found that something must be done in @mynetworks and local_maps, I don't know... However, I don't have amavis.conf file in my system...

Anyone has any experience with Amavis ? Can anyone help me set up amavis accordingly ? And what does "RelayedOpenRelay" mean ?
